We were floating behind our boat during a Fleet 15 raft up and one of the other owners mentioned that the stern rail on our MkI is just like the stern rail on his C30. He modified it by cutting out part of the lower rail and putting in a couple of 90 degree fittings with a short stanchion to brace it. I made the change this past weekend. This will make it much easier to get into the boat without having to step over the lower rail. See photos below.
